The Alpine Recovery Lodge Bi-Annual $1,000 Scholarship Essay Contest

At Alpine Recovery Lodge, we believe it’s our responsibility to give back to the community and help those looking to better themselves through an education, specifically students who have been directly affected by addiction.

Over the past few decades, the rising cost of college tuition has far outpaced the rate of inflation. Higher education is more expensive than ever before. According to the College Board, the average cost of a year of tuition and fees at a public four-year in-state university is over $9,000. This figure doesn’t include high-priced textbooks, computers, graphing calculators, and other expensive materials that are often required to complete courses.

Twice a year, we award $1,000 to students in need to help them receive the education they deserve. High school seniors, undergrads, and graduate students are welcome to apply. Applicant must be a resident of Utah, Colorado, Idaho, Wyoming, New Mexico, Arizona or Nevada.  To apply, please submit an essay detailing how addiction has directly affected you. A winner will be chosen based on strength of essay and financial need.

Applicants must abide by the following deadlines:

  • Summer Deadline – July 1st
  • Winter Deadline – November 1th

Include your full name, physical address, email address, phone number, and proof that you are currently enrolled in high school or college (recent transcript, etc.) along with your essay.
